    Mine is a 15" TC Custom Shop barrel on a Contender. I have never hunted deerwith the 6, but do occasionally use the 7mm TCU for deer. My six is used to help control these PA ground hogs and is quite a shooter. Twice I have shot a 5 shot group at 100 yds that measured an honest 5/8". Mine loves IMR 4198, but I am using lighter bullets. I did some work years back with heavier bullets, I'll look at my records to see if I have any data that could help you. Keep us informed on your progress, I'm very interested.

    I have a new ProChrono chronograph to try out. Efforts to get a Caldwell going went no place. It took five minutes to get this machine connected to the phone.

    I had made a run of 8mm Mauser for a Husqvarna sporter. These will be the first handloads for this rifle. I used 175gr. Sierra spitzers and PPU brass. The charge was a minimum of SW4350. Some 270's rounds were loaded up for the 700 Mountain Rifle. I was using 51 and 52 grs. of SW4350. The bullets 140gr Hornady SST's. The local mall ninja store had maybe a hundred boxes. Anyway, the plan is to take these rifles, rounds and chronograph to the range this weekend.
